Fray Check. It comes in a small clear bottle with a blue cap. Works great on most fabric, but test it first to make sure it doesn't stain. You can find it at most craft stores near the pins and sewing things. With fray check I recommend squeezing some out into a disposable container and using a too...

You can get a Foamies craft sheet, some silver acrylic paint, 6 large paper brads and a strip of fabric. Cut the band front from the foam, and poke the brads through the appropriate spots (where the rivets are) and then paint it all silver. Paint your symbol on in black, or use silver puff paint to ...
